Learning on the Go

NO PRIOR

EXPERIENCE REQUIRED

At Overland, students are not expected to have prior experience. Instead, our leaders are trained to be teachers themselves. Their goal is to welcome their students to the outdoors in supportive, inclusive ways and to show them how to be successful on their trip. Students will contribute meaningfully throughout the trip: learning to set up and take down their tents; shopping for, preparing, and cleaning up group meals; packing their own backpacks; and more specialized tasks depending on student age and trip itinerary. Sharing these daily tasks creates spirited groups and enstills a sense of ownership for the students.
